How to Use a Solar Calculator to Estimate Your Energy Savings


Understanding Solar Calculators: A Brief Overview


Solar calculators are essential tools for homeowners and businesses seeking to transition to renewable energy. These calculators estimate potential energy savings from solar panel installations. By inputting specific data, users can assess how much they can save on their electricity bills and the return on investment (ROI) for solar energy systems.

The Importance of Estimating Energy Savings


Estimating energy savings is crucial for various reasons. It allows individuals to:
- **Make informed decisions:** Understanding potential savings helps in deciding whether to invest in solar energy.
- **Budget effectively:** Knowing the cost savings can aid in financial planning and budgeting for renewable energy investments.
- **Promote sustainability:** By quantifying savings, users become more motivated to adopt eco-friendly practices and reduce their carbon footprint.

Key Factors to Consider Before Using a Solar Calculator


Before diving into the calculations, it's essential to gather the necessary information. Here are some key factors to consider:

Your Location


Solar energy production varies significantly by location. Areas with abundant sunlight will yield higher energy production. Check the average solar irradiance in your region through local climate data.

Your Energy Consumption


Understanding your energy consumption is critical. Review your past utility bills to determine your average monthly usage in kilowatt-hours (kWh). This number will serve as a baseline for your calculations.

Solar Panel System Size


The size of the solar panel system you intend to install will influence your energy savings. Larger systems generally produce more electricity but also require a higher initial investment.

Incentives and Rebates


Many regions offer financial incentives and rebates for solar panel installations. Research local and federal programs that could enhance your savings.

Step-by-Step Guide to Using a Solar Calculator


Step 1: Choose the Right Solar Calculator


Not all solar calculators are created equal. Look for a reputable solar calculator that considers various factors such as location, energy consumption, and system size. Some popular options include:
- **EnergySage**
- **Solar-Estimate**
- **PVWatts**

Step 2: Input Your Location


Once you've selected a calculator, begin by entering your location. This information will help tailor the solar production estimates based on regional sunlight availability.

Step 3: Enter Your Energy Consumption Data


Provide your average monthly energy consumption data in kWh. This information is typically found on utility bills. Calculators may allow you to enter annual totals or monthly averages.

Step 4: Specify System Size and Type


Determine the size of the solar panel system you are considering. Input the total wattage of the solar panels you plan to install. The calculator may also let you choose between different types of solar systems (e.g., grid-tied, off-grid).

Step 5: Input Financial Incentives


To get a more accurate savings estimate, input any financial incentives, tax credits, or rebates available in your area. This could significantly influence your ROI.

Step 6: Review Your Savings Estimate


After entering all necessary data, the calculator will generate an estimate of your energy savings. Review the results carefully, as they will indicate the potential savings on your electricity bill, payback period, and overall return on investment.

Interpreting the Results: What Do They Mean?


Once you've obtained your energy savings estimate, it's essential to understand the details:

Monthly and Annual Savings


The calculator should provide both monthly and annual savings estimates. This information helps you understand how quickly you can recover your initial investment.

Payback Period


The payback period indicates how long it will take to recoup your investment in solar panels through energy savings. A shorter payback period is generally more favorable.

Return on Investment (ROI)

The Long-Term Benefits of Using Solar Energy


Investing in solar energy yields numerous long-term benefits, including:

Lower Electricity Bills


Solar energy significantly reduces or even eliminates monthly electricity bills. This can lead to substantial savings over time, especially as utility rates continue to rise.

Increased Home Value


Homes with solar panel installations tend to have higher property values. Potential buyers often view solar energy as an attractive feature, making these homes more desirable in the real estate market.

Environmental Impact


Transitioning to solar energy contributes to a healthier planet. Solar power reduces reliance on fossil fuels, lowers greenhouse gas emissions, and supports the shift towards sustainability.

Frequently Asked Questions (FAQs)


1. How accurate are solar calculators?


Solar calculators provide estimates based on input data. While they are generally accurate, individual results may vary depending on specific circumstances.

2. Can I use a solar calculator for commercial purposes?


Yes, many solar calculators can be used for both residential and commercial applications. Just ensure to input the correct data related to your business’s energy usage.

3. Do solar calculators factor in weather conditions?


Most solar calculators use historical climate data to estimate solar energy production based on average sunlight hours. They do not predict future weather conditions.

4. Are there any hidden costs when installing solar panels?


While solar calculators provide estimates, additional costs such as installation fees, maintenance, and potential upgrades should be considered when budgeting for solar energy.

5. How long does it take to install solar panels?


The installation timeline can vary, but it typically takes between one to three days for a residential solar panel system to be installed, depending on the system's size and complexity.
